Compare the rivalry schools - Louisiana State University-Alexandria and Southern University and A & M College.

Louisiana State University-Alexandria (LSUA) is a Public, 4-years school located in Alexandria, LA and Southern University and A & M College is a Public, 4-years school located in Baton Rouge, LA. Following list and table compares two rivalry schools in various academic factors.
  • Louisiana State University-Alexandria has higher submitted SAT score (1,000) than Southern University and A & M College (890).
  • Southern University and A & M College (53.90% acceptance rate) is tighter than Louisiana State University-Alexandria (57.67% acceptance rate) to get in.
  • Southern University and A & M College (8,226 students) is larger than Louisiana State University-Alexandria (4,289 students).
  • Southern University and A & M College has more expensive tuition & fees of $17,198 than Louisiana State University-Alexandria($14,650).
  • Southern University and A & M College has more full-time faculties of 308 faculties than Louisiana State University-Alexandria(86 facluties).
